Output 3f7781aca7b94b15fd71dbdb82d4a2bea47877526e309d756c5584ff51ea7052:0

value
31742868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03d32ec37c4187b8b0dd5a45cb64c6b70f67fecd OP_EQUALVERIFY OP_CHECKSIG
address
1ME1ofuJESwFr1fxQAy9iVRQmFghMR1yT
transaction
3f7781aca7b94b15fd71dbdb82d4a2bea47877526e309d756c5584ff51ea7052
spent
true